Maharashtra:'Becoming Governor Is Like Locking Mouth,' Says NCP Leader Chhagan Bhujbal

Discontented over being excluded from the Mahayuti cabinet, veteran NCP leader Chhagan Bhujbal has once again voiced his frustration. In an effort to pacify him, the NCP has reportedly offered him positions like a Rajya Sabha member or Governor.
However, Bhujbal dismissed the idea, stating, “Becoming Governor would be like locking my mouth. What would I do as a Governor?” He emphasised that his primary commitment has always been to addressing issues faced by the underprivileged. “As Governor, would I be able to resolve those problems? I do not want to dishonor the position of Governor,” he remarked.
Bhujbal further asserted that those in power should explain why he was not made a minister. While he acknowledged that political situations change, he maintained that he had no objections. However, he reiterated his dedication to fighting for the common people and stated that he would not accept positions that would limit his ability to continue his work.
Reflecting on his political journey, Bhujbal recalled the Lok Sabha elections, where he was encouraged to contest due to his strong track record in Nashik and the support he received from the community. However, a month later, his name was not announced, leading to his withdrawal from the race.
